How to reach Museo Nazionale di Spina — Ferrara
The closest international airport is Bologna (BLQ). Rimini (RMI) is a viable alternative, especially when combining Museo Nazionale di Spina — Ferrara with other Italian destinations.
A rental car is the most flexible option for exploring Emilia-Romagna's smaller villages around Museo Nazionale di Spina — Ferrara; regional trains and intercity buses also connect the area for 5-25€ per leg.
